Pte. John Joseph Tasker
British Army 2nd Battalion Lincolnshire Regiment
from:Spalding
(d.31st July 1917)
It starts with the family tree and becomes a mystery to be uncovered. John Tasker was the brother of my great nan. He was born in Spalding of parents George Tasker and Rebecca Hare White. He had 4 sisters and one brother. His mother died quite young and the family was split up.
Lots of military records have been destroyed from the Blitz so they are a bit thin on the ground. I know that he is on the Roll of Honour at the Ayscoughfee War Memorial. He is also on the daily casualty lists.
His father collected his personal effects including his medals. I believe that he died at Passchendale, although I can't confirm this.
He has no known grave and his name is not on any commonwealth war memorial as yet. I hope this will be rectified soon.
102 years late but never too late to be remembered.
